VALOR Communications Group Inc., Names Jerry E. Vaughn Chief Financial Officer and Grant Raney Chief Operating Officer

IRVING, Texas, Sept. 19 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- VALOR
Communications Group Inc. (NYSE:VCG), today announced two key
appointments to the company's senior executive team. Jerry E.
Vaughn has been named senior vice president and chief financial
officer, effective Oct. 1, 2005. Grant Raney, currently senior vice
president of operations, sales and marketing, has also been named
chief operating officer (COO), effective immediately. Vaughn and
Raney will report to John (Jack) J. Mueller, VALOR's president and
chief executive officer. "We are excited and very pleased to have
Jerry join our company and the ranks of a superior senior executive
team," said Mueller. "Jerry's leadership and public company
experience expand the team's capacity to manage our business
strategically in a highly competitive telecommunications
environment. Grant's appointment as COO recognizes the broad scope
of operational responsibility he has held for the past year."
Vaughn, 60, will relocate to the company's Irving headquarters and
will lead the accounting, finance, investor relations, tax and
treasury departments. Most recently, from June 1999 until July
2005, Vaughn was chief financial officer for Louisiana-based U.S.
Unwired, where he led the company's finance and accounting
organizations through an initial public stock offering, several
high-yield debt and credit facility transactions, acquisitions of
complementary businesses and divestitures of assets. U.S. Unwired
grew from less than $100 million in revenue to $500 million in
revenue before that company was sold to Sprint. Vaughn has 12 years
of telecommunications experience and more than 25 years of
diversified financial management experience. He has led several
large capital market transactions in both the pre- and post-
Sarbanes-Oxley environment. "The timing of VALOR's recent IPO and
recapitalization creates a compelling opportunity to build upon
VALOR's leading industry position as a rural telecommunications
service provider," said Vaughn. Vaughn will serve as VALOR's
principal financial officer with Randal Dumas continuing as
principal accounting officer for U.S. Securities and Exchange
Commission reporting. Keith Terreri will also continue as vice
president of finance, treasurer and investor relations officer. As
a founding member of VALOR's management team, Grant Raney, 45, will
continue leading the operations, sales and marketing organizations
as senior vice president and chief operating officer. Raney was
named senior vice president of operations and engineering in 2001,
and his management responsibilities expanded to include the
company's sales and marketing organizations in August 2004. Prior
to joining VALOR in February 2000 as operations vice president,
Raney served as division vice president at Spectra Communications
Group, a partnership of CenturyTel, Inc., a company he joined in
1979. Raney has more than 25 years of telecommunications industry
experience in a variety of roles with increasing responsibilities.
He served as VALOR's principal operations architect during the
company's business start-up in 2000 and was instrumental in the
development of the company's Alternative Form of Regulation Plan,
which guides VALOR's capital investment plan in the State of New
Mexico. Raney also was responsible for significantly improving the
company's service quality standards and customer satisfaction
measures. Today, he oversees more than 1,100 employees with primary
responsibility for interfacing with VALOR's customers in Arkansas,
New Mexico, Oklahoma and Texas. Vaughn will join Raney, Cynthia B.
Nash, senior vice president and chief information officer, and
William M. Ojile Jr., senior vice president, chief legal officer
and secretary, in reporting to Mueller. About VALOR Communications
Group VALOR Communications Group (NYSE:VCG) is one of the largest
providers of telecommunications services in rural communities in
the southwestern United States. The company, through its subsidiary
VALOR Telecom, offers to residential, business and government
customers a wide range of telecommunications services, including:
local exchange telephone services, which covers basic dial-tone
service as well as enhanced services, such as caller
identification, voicemail and call waiting; long distance services;
and data services, such as providing digital subscriber lines.
VALOR Communications Group is headquartered in Irving, Texas. For
